Government has announced a National General Cleaning Exercise as part of efforts to restore communities affected by recent flooding and improve environmental sanitation.

The exercise aims to clear choked drains, remove refuse, and reduce the risk of future flooding while protecting lives, property, and public health.

The government has directed all District Chief Executives, Assembly Members, Government Appointees, Security Agencies, staff of the District Assemblies, heads of institutions, business operators, and residents to actively participate and lead the exercise in their respective communities.

 

In the Gomoa East District, the clean-up exercise will be held along the Kakraba–Millennium–Nyanyano–Kojo Oku Road, with participants expected to assemble at Millennium Junction. Activities will begin at 6:00 a.m. and end at 12:00 noon failure to do so will attract sanctions.

 

Residents of Asikuma Odoben Brakwa , Gomoa East District ,Awutu Senya East Municipality and all other districts within the central region are urged to come out in their numbers to support the initiative.

 

Some DCE’s within the Central Region have been speaking with BKB, they say the success of the exercise depends on collective community participation and is a crucial step towards restoring flood-affected areas and preventing future disasters.
